The SOFA agreement between Cyprus and France signifies a broad collaboration that includes military activities on the island. This agreement, scheduled to be signed in June, outlines the terms for the presence and operations of French forces in Cyprus. The cooperation focuses on enhancing military and defense technologies and includes strategic exercises and joint actions. Additionally, it addresses legal jurisdiction and government cooperation. Cyprus gains a role as a pillar of stability in the Eastern Mediterranean.
